Cooling often occurs in geothermal wells, especially after exploitation for quite several years, including in the Wayang Windu geothermal field. This cooling problem can lead to a reduction in production leading to a shortage of power plants to generate electricity. Identifying and analyzing the root cause of the problems that occur in geothermal wells is important to know the right preventive action plan. Analyzing the behavior of geothermal wells requires an understanding of what parameters can affect the phenomena that occurs. This study aims to identify the occurrence of cooling in well “X”. The identification process is carried out by analyzing field data such as PT shut-in data, geochemical data, and daily production data. Data analysis is not only done by looking at each data, but there must be a relationship between these data that causes this well to cool down. After this well is identified to have cooling problem, a minimum temperature analysis that can be carried out by this well to be able to produce up to the production pipeline at pressure conditions at the production facility is required. This calculation process uses an In-house simulator with parameters that match the results of the previous cooling analysis.
